TwinTitan / UC-iOS-cw-6

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

التمرين 1

alt_text

1. قم بفتح ملف Xcode

2. قم بانشاء تطبيق جديد باسم StudentsInfo

3. قم بعمل struct بإسم StudentsDetails

4. قم بعمل خصائص لهذا struct بهذه الاسماء كمتغيرات :

fullName - Year - Age

حيث أن :

* fullName من نوع String

* Year من نوع Int

* Age من نوع Int.

5. قم بعمل ٣ متغيرات من نوع كائنات عن طريق الهيكل، واضف بيانات خاصة لهم.

6. قم بعمل متغير واحد كمصفوفة من نوع الكائن لهذا ال struct بإسم students. وضع المتغيرات الثلاث "الذي قمت بإنشائهم بخطوة ٥" إلى هذا المتغير.

7. قم بعرض هذه الأسماء على صفحة التطبيق كما هو موضح في الصورة.

hint✨: يمكنك استخدام list لعرضهم بهذه الطريقة.



التمرين 2

alt_text

1. قم بفتح ملف Xcode

2. قم بانشاء تطبيق جديد باسم myDiary

3. قم بعمل مصفوفة من الألوان

4. قم بعمل textField

5. قم بعمل NavigationView , وقم بالخطوات اللازمة للانتقال الى صفحة جديدة لتنقل بها اللون الذي اخترته عند الضغط عليه ليكون خلفية في الصفحة الثانية ،وايضا تنقل النص الموجود في خانة textField . كما هو موضح في الصورة.

hint✨: مصفوفة الألوان تكون بهذه الطريقة

let chooseColor = [Color.black , Color.gray , Color.blue , Color.green]

About


Languages

Language:Swift 100.0%